What is Trampoline Exercise?
Trampoline exercise is jumping on a trampoline. It is also called rebounding. People of all ages can do it. It is a great way to stay active.
Pros of Trampoline Exercise
There are many benefits to trampoline exercise. Here are some of them:
1. Fun And Enjoyable
Jumping on a trampoline is fun. It does not feel like exercise. Kids and adults both enjoy it. It can make you happy and excited.
2. Good For Your Heart
Trampoline exercise is good for your heart. It makes your heart beat faster. This is good for your health. It helps your heart stay strong.
3. Helps With Weight Loss
Jumping on a trampoline burns calories. This helps with weight loss. It is a good way to stay in shape.
4. Builds Strong Muscles
Trampoline exercise builds strong muscles. Your legs, arms, and core get stronger. It is a full-body workout.
5. Improves Balance And Coordination
Jumping on a trampoline improves balance. It also helps with coordination. This can help you in other sports and activities.
6. Low Impact On Joints
Trampoline exercise is gentle on your joints. It is low impact. This means it does not hurt your knees and ankles like running can.
7. Boosts Mental Health
Exercise on a trampoline can boost your mood. It can reduce stress and anxiety. It helps you feel better mentally.

Cons of Trampoline Exercise
There are also some risks to trampoline exercise. Here are a few:
1. Risk Of Injury
Jumping on a trampoline can be risky. You can fall and get hurt. Sprains, strains, and fractures can happen.
2. Expensive Equipment
Trampolines can be expensive. Good quality trampolines cost a lot. They also need space in your yard or home.
3. Requires Supervision
Kids need supervision while jumping. They can get hurt easily. An adult should always watch them.
4. Weather Dependent
Outdoor trampolines depend on the weather. Rain, snow, or strong wind can stop you from using them. Indoor trampolines are better for all seasons.
5. Limited Exercise Variety
Trampoline exercise can get boring. There are fewer ways to change it up. This can make it less exciting over time.
How to Stay Safe
Safety is important with trampoline exercise. Here are some tips:
- Always use a safety net.
- Check the trampoline before use.
- Do not jump too high.
- Do not do flips or tricks.
- Only one person should jump at a time.
